Medicinal herbs

UPDATED 20161103 11:11:26

Herbs have been used in healing for centuries. Explore their historic and current uses in orthodox and alternative traditions, drawing on manuscripts and early publications. Gain practical skills in identifying herbs. This course includes two offsite visits on Fridays 27 Jan and 3 Feb from 14:00 to 16:30 to Chelsea Physic Garden and the Wellcome Library to see a range of manuscripts and early herbals on medicinal plants. Course fees do not include entry fees.
